CVE-2003-1079
Unknown vulnerability in UDP RPC for Solaris 2.5.1 through 9 for SPARC, and 2.5.1 through 8 for x86,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service memory consumption via certain arguments in RPC calls that cause large amounts of memory to be allocated...

CVE-2003-1071
rpc.walld wall daemon for Solaris 2.6 through 9 allows local users to send messages to logged on users that appear to come from arbitrary user IDs by closing stderr before executing wall, then supplying a spoofed from header...
CVE-2002-1296
Directory traversal vulnerability in priocntl system call in Solaris does allows local users to execute arbitrary code via ".." sequences in the pcclname field of a pcinfot structure, which cause priocntl to load a malicious kernel module...
CVE-2002-1586
Solaris 2.5.1 through 9 allows local users to cause a denial of service kernel panic by setting the sdstruiowrq variable in the struioget function to null, which triggers a null dereference...

CVE-2002-0573
Format string vulnerability in RPC wall daemon rpc.rwalld for Solaris 2.5.1 through 8 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via format strings in a message that is not properly provided to the syslog function when the wall command cannot be executed...

CVE-2002-0085
cachefsd in Solaris 2.6, 7, and 8 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service crash via an invalid procedure call in an RPC request...
